S-1112B48PI-L7HTFG Equivalent & Substitute Parts

Part Overview

The S-1112B48PI-L7HTFG is a linear voltage regulator IC from ABLIC Inc. designed for positive fixed output applications. This device delivers 150mA output current at a fixed 4.8V output voltage with a maximum input voltage of 6.5V. The part is classified as obsolete, making identification of suitable substitute components essential for ongoing design support and production continuity. Equivalent and parametrically compatible alternatives are available from the same manufacturer in active product status.

Engineering Selection Recommendations

S-1112B48PI-L7HTFU is the direct equivalent substitute. This part maintains identical electrical specifications and packaging format while offering the advantage of active product status. It is suitable for direct replacement in applications currently using the obsolete S-1112B48PI-L7HTFG. Both parts share the same series designation, package type (SNT-6A), and performance characteristics. This option provides the most straightforward migration path with no design modifications required.

S-1167B48-I6T2U is a parametrically equivalent alternative from an improved product series. While maintaining the same output voltage, current rating, input voltage range, and package configuration, this part demonstrates enhanced performance in specific parameters: reduced dropout voltage (0.21V vs. 0.26V @ 100mA), lower quiescent current (900nA vs. 1µA), and significantly reduced supply current (16µA vs. 90µA). The PSRR specification is lower (65dB vs. 80dB @ 1kHz). This option is suitable for applications where lower power consumption and reduced dropout voltage provide system-level benefits. Both substitute options maintain full compliance with ROHS3, REACH, and MSL requirements.
